WeatherTech Side Window Deflector for 2007-2018 Mercedes-Be…

Rating: 42 reviews from 1 sources

Reviews

Selected Review of 42 Reviews

This cuts down the wind noise a lot. Wosh I added it earlier.Read full review

www.amazon.ca